Block diagram of cpu architecture pdf

You must be able to outline the architecture of the central processing unit cpu and the functions of the. The input section converts the field signals supplied by input devicessensors to logiclevel signals that the. Cpu memory system address data ads wr rdy figure 914 microprocessor bus interface. Many simt threads grouped together into gpu core simt threads in a group. This article gives an overview of arm architecture with each modules principle of working. What is arm processor arm architecture and applications.

Arm architecture o reduced instruction set computer risc architecture n a large set of registers n a loadstore architecture o process values in registers and place the results into a register o data processing operations only operate on register contents, not directly on memory contents n uniform and fixedlength instruction fields. The central processing unit is the heart of the plc system. Below is a block diagram of a computer along with various io processors. Cpu performance also depends upon the ram, bus speed and cache size as well. Learn how a cpu works in an easy to follow language, including topics such as clock, memory cache, cpu block diagram, an overall view on the basic cpu units, pipeline, superscalar architecture. Architecture of computer system computer architecture. These are used to represent the control systems in pictorial form. Computer organization and architecture lecture notes shri vishnu. We will discuss the nvidia tegra 4 processors gpu physical pipeline below and refer to the tegra 4 processor, but many of the general descriptions, aside from unit counts, apply to the tegra 4i processor as well. It was introduced by the acron computer organization in 1987.

Block diagrams consist of a single block or a combination of blocks. An 8 kb sram block intended to be utilized mainly by the usb interrupt controller the vectored. Arm7lpcfeaturesand architecture icon based microcontroller lpc features, architecture block diagram and its description. In this article you will get to know about the definition, architecture, block diagram and working of 8085 microprocessor. Block diagram of an nvidia gpu each thread has its own pc. Computer architecture has undergone incredible changes in the past 20 years, from the. Block diagram of the avr architecture abelardo pardo. It defines a highspeed, highbandwidth bus, the advanced high performance bus ahb.

View and download siemens cpu c hardware and installation manual online. Horizon 7 architecture planning horizon 7 architecture planning provides an introduction to vmware horizon 7, including a description of its major features and deployment options and an overview of how the components are typically set up in a production environment. Figure 412 shows the functional block diagram of our arm processor. The risc architecture is an attempt to produce more cpu power by simplifying the instruction set of the cpu. Jun 24, 2014 video describing the main blocks of the avr architecture and its purpose when executing an instruction. Computer organization and architecture microoperations. Block, core, and functional diagrams the arm7tdmi processor architecture, core, and functional diagrams are illustrated in the following figures. The value of those signals for each instruction at every state is explained in appendix a.

The input section converts the field signals supplied by input devicessensors to logiclevel signals that the plcs cpu can read. Plc programmable logic control block diagram, input. Although it transfers data without intervention of processor, it is controlled by the processor. Arms developer website includes documentation, tutorials, support resources and more. Figure 91 block diagram of static ram table 91 truth table for static ram mode io pins.

All the slaves in the system are connected to the same system bus. Cpu c2 dp the functions fcs and function blocks fbs can be stored in the cpu in encrypted form 3. The tegra 4 processors gpu architecture diagram below figure. Included are descriptions of the central processing unit cpu architecture, bus structure, memory structure, onchip peripherals, and the instruction set. The cpu is a microprocessor based control system that replaces central relays, counters, timers and sequencers. The basic elements of a block diagram are a block, the summing point and the takeoff point. Jul 02, 2017 the full form of cpu is central processing unit. Below we see a simplified diagram describing the overall architecture of a cpu. It is because the processing speed of central processing unit cpu is so fast that the data has to be provided to cpu with the same speed.

Architecture of 8085 microprocessor with block diagram 8085. Block diagram of intel 8086 features of 8086 microprocessor. Block, core, and functional diagrams arm architecture. A cpu is an electronics circuit used in a computer that fetches the input instructions or commands from the memory unit, performs arithmetic and logic operations and stores this processed data back to memory. Various functions of cpu and operations are generally performed by these 3 units are described below.

Block diagram of a hypothetical simple cpu, showing instruction fetch, decode, data registers, alu, and memory interface, and major relationships. Hardware architecture may be implemented to be either hardware specific or software specific, but according to the application both are used in the required quantity. Lecture 2 risc architecture philadelphia university. It controls the overall working by selecting the operation to be done. Internal block diagram of 8086 free download as powerpoint presentation. How a cpu works block diagram of a cpu of 10 hardware secrets. Both riscs and ciscs try to solve the same problem.

Oct 20, 2017 the following image shows the 8051 microcontroller architecture in a block diagram style. Inputoutput processor computer architecture tutorial. Pdf cpu8087 64bit 80bit 18digit 0032bit 02bit 1064bit 1116bit 8086 opcode sheet with mnemonics free 8087 microprocessor block diagram and pin diagram i8087 8087 microprocessor block diagram 8087 architecture and configuration intel 8087 8086 opcode sheet free 8087 data types 8087 coprocessor architecture 8087 microprocessor. Readwrite control logic it is a control block for overall device. Draw and explain block diagram of microprocessor based system. A simplified block diagram of a plc shown in above fig. The block diagram of the 8051 microcontroller architecture shows that 8051 microcontroller consists of a cpu, ram sfrs and data memory, flash eeprom, io ports and control logic for communication between the peripherals. The control unit controls the flow of data within the cpu which is the fetchexecute cycle. Advanced microcontroller bus architecture it is a specification for an onchip bus, to enable macrocells such as a cpu, dsp, peripherals, and memory controllers to be connected together to form a microcontroller or complex peripheral chip. The opposed trend to risc is that of complex instruction set computers cisc. Let us consider the block diagram of a closed loop control system as shown in the. Introduction to computer system block diagram of digital computer system. Advanced microcontroller bus architecture it is a specification for an onchip bus, to enable macrocells such as a cpu, dsp, peripherals, and memory controllers to be connected together to form a microcontroller or complex.

Cpu or central processing unit is the brain of the computer system. Dma controller in computer architecture, advantages and. How a cpu works block diagram of a cpu of 10 hardware. Block diagram of computer can performs basically five major computer. The central processing unit cpu again consists of alu arithmetic logic unit and control unit.

Video describing the main blocks of the avr architecture and its purpose when executing an instruction. The block diagram of processor unit is shown in figure below where all registers are connected through common buses. Dma controller contains an address unit, for generating addresses and selecting io device for transfer. Since a cpu performs a lot of calculations at a high speed, it gets heat up quickly. What is risc and cisc architecture with advantages and. A computer can process data, pictures, sound and graphics. Permission is granted to copy, distribute andor modify this document under the terms of the gnu free documentation license, version 1. Tms320c54x dsp functional overview 1 tms320c54x dsp functional overview this document provides a functional overview of the devices included in the texas instrument tms320c54x generation of digital signal processors. A copy of the license is included in the section entitled gnu free documentation license. Pdf introduction to computer system block diagram of. The cpu processes the data required for solving the computational tasks. Alternatively, it is also known by the name of processor, microprocessor or a computer processor. Computer organization and architecture microoperations execution of an instruction the instruction cycle has a number of smaller units fetch, indirect, execute, interrupt, etc each part of the cycle has a number of smaller steps called microoperations discussed extensive in pipelining microops are the fundamental or atomic. Occur only under a predetermined control condition.

Internal block diagram of 8086 instruction set computer data. A cpu perspective 29 gpu core gpu core gpu gpu architecture opencl early cpu languages were light abstractions of physical hardware e. Msp430 cpu introduction risc architecture with 27 instructions and 7 addressing modes. Included are descriptions of the central processing unit cpu architecture. Although the architecture is straightforward and remarkably wellsupported, the. Develops the architecture and licenses it to other companies other companies design their own products that implement one of those architecturesincludingsystemsonchipssoc andsystemsonmodulessom that incorporate memory, interfaces, radios, etc. Explanation of block diagram of computercomputer notes.

A central processing unit cpu is the electronic circuitry within a computer that carries out the instructions of a computer program by performing the basic arithmetic, logical, control and inputoutput io operations specified by the instructions. What is basic block diagram of computer system block diagram of computer system the computer system consists of mainly three types that are central processing unit cpu,input devices, and output devices. Micro channel architecture mca bus what is coprocessor. The first comes from the register file while the other comes from the shifter. The cpu interface is provided to demultiplex, the multiplexed lines, to generate chip select signals and additional control signals. Separate busses for instruction memory and data memory. Figure 98 block diagram of ram system figure 99 sm chart of ram system. Cpu harvard architecture data memory p rog am memory 8bit bus 16bit bus o risc designs are also more likely to feature this model o note that having separate address spaces can create issues for highlevel programming no supporting different address spaces not good for cisc. Block diagram of computer and explain its various components. Over the next few months we will be adding more developer resources and documentation for all the products and technologies that arm provides. The arm architecture processor is an advanced reduced instruction set computing risc machine and its a 32bit reduced instruction set computer risc microcontroller.

Functions of cpu varies from data processing to controlling inputoutput devices. A more detailed structure diagram is shown in figure 1. Ciscs are going the traditional way of implementing more and more complex instructions. Typical system with intel atom processor soc similarly, many intel architecture chips now boast multicore performance, meaning that two or more intel architecture processor cores, or engines, operate within a single chip. In this article you will get to know about the definition, architecture, block diagram and working of 8085. Control unit controls communication within alu and memory unit. It also contains the control unit and data count for keeping counts of the number of blocks transferred and indicating the direction of transfer of data. Each and every instruction no matter how complex or simple, it has to go through the cpu. The data transmission is possible between 8251 and cpu by the data bus buffer block. The 8086 cpu is divided into two independent functional units. Architecture tms320c54x dsp functional overview 7 1. Figure 91 block diagram of static ram table 91 truth. Architecture of the central processing unit cpu computer.

They can be used to store and transfer the data from the registers by using instruction. Block diagram of computer can performs basically five major computer operations or functions irrespective of their size and make. The following image shows the 8051 microcontroller architecture in a block diagram style. The memory unit occupies the central position and can communicate with each processor. Arm architecture o reduced instruction set computer risc architecture n a large set of registers n a loadstore architecture o process values in registers and place the results into a register o data processing. Orthogonal architecture with every instruction usable with every addressing mode. The iop provides a path for transfer of data between peripherals and memory. A cpu perspective 30 gpu core gpu core gpu ndrange. Dma controller provides an interface between the bus and the inputoutput devices. Graphics processing units gpus stephane zuckerman slides include material from d.

1403 1509 1166 1274 665 369 235 603 1423 1198 97 1123 1202 764 460 79 434 1215 977 1102 774 416 614 1060 1163 957 49 197 764 1411 518 569 558 132 114 591 119